 April 4, 1966: CURV attaches one line to the apex of the bomb’s parachute with its specially designed grapnel. |
 April 5, 1966: Grapnel and lines. According to CURV operator Larry Brady, when CURV went to Spain, its depth gauge didn’t work well below 2,000 feet, and its altimeter, which measured CURV’s distance from bottom, didn’t work at all. |
